The First Disciples

The First Disciples

(Matthew 4:18–22, Luke 5:1–11, John 1:35–42)

16As [Jesus] was walking beside the Sea of Galilee, He saw Simon and [his] brother Andrew. They were casting a net into the sea, for they were fishermen. 17“Come, follow Me,” Jesus said “and I will make you fishers of men.” 18And at once they left [their] nets [and] followed Him.

19Going on a little [farther], He saw James [son] of Zebedee and his brother John. They [were] in a boat, mending [their] nets. 20Immediately [Jesus] called them, and they left their father Zebedee in the boat with the hired men [and] followed Him.
